The ballistic protection steel with extra-high hardness
600HBW ballistic steel is a ballistic protection steel of extra-high hardness, nominal 600 HBW, available in thicknesses of 3‑6 mm (0.118‑0.236″).
600HBW ballistic steel is available as cut-to-length sheet in thicknesses of 3‑6 mm (0.118‑0.236″). Delivered in quenched condition, 600HBW ballistic steel is not intended for further heat treatment.

Mechanical Properties
Thickness (mm) | Hardness (HBW) |
3.0 – 6.0 | 570 - 640 |
Mechanical Testing
Brinell hardness test according to EN ISO 6506-1 on each heat treatment individual/coil.
Hardness is measured on a milled surface 0.3 - 2 mm below plate surface.
Chemical Composition (ladle analysis), %, max
C | Si | Mn | P | S | Cr | Ni | Mo | B |
0.40 | 0.70 | 1.50 | 0.015 | 0.010 | 1.00 | 2.50 | 0.8 | 0.005 |
The steel is grain-refined.
Phosphorous and sulphur are not intentionally alloying elements.

Fabrication and Other Recommendations
Welding, bending and machining
600HBW ballistic steel is not intended for further heat treatment. If 600HBW ballistic steel is heated above 150 °C after delivery from VANFORGE no guarantees for the properties are given.
Appropriate health and safety precautions must be taken when cutting, welding, grinding or otherwise working on the product. Grinding, especially of primer coated plates, may produce dust with high particle concentration.
